Environmental Impact of Furniture Disposal

Eco-friendly methods in furniture disposal

Improper disposal of furniture can lead to significant environmental harm. Large items often contain materials that are not biodegradable and can persist in landfills for decades. Metals, plastics, and treated wood used in furniture construction can leach harmful chemicals into the soil and water sources.

Additionally, the production of new furniture consumes valuable resources and energy. By responsibly disposing of old furniture through **bulky waste collection**, you contribute to the reduction of resource consumption and lower the overall carbon footprint associated with furniture manufacturing.

Recycling and reusing furniture materials help conserve natural resources and reduce waste. For example, wooden furniture can be repurposed into new products, and metal components can be melted down and reused, minimizing the need for new raw materials.

Impact of Legislation on Waste Collection Services

Government legislation significantly influences how **bulky waste collection** services operate. Policies aimed at reducing waste and promoting recycling mandate that service providers adhere to specific standards and practices.

Legislation such as extended producer responsibility (EPR) requires manufacturers to take responsibility for the entire lifecycle of their products, including disposal. This encourages companies to design furniture that is easier to recycle and reduces environmental impact.

Compliance with such laws not only aligns waste collection services with regulatory requirements but also promotes broader environmental sustainability goals, benefiting communities and ecosystems alike.

Consumer Tips for Sustainable Furniture Disposal

Consumers can adopt several strategies to ensure their furniture disposal is as sustainable as possible:

  • Donate: If the furniture is still in good condition, consider donating it to a local charity or non-profit organization.
  • Sell or Upcycle: Selling used furniture or repurposing it into something new can extend its useful life and reduce waste.
  • Recycle: Ensure that materials like wood, metal, and plastic are recycled through appropriate channels.
  • Repair: Fixing minor damages can make old furniture usable again, delaying the need for disposal.
